What it is
Autonomous AI Agency is a self-hosted platform that turns one website URL into a working AI operations team. It scans your site's tech stack, provisions the specialist agents your business actually needs (from 35 families), and runs them 24x7 on hardware you control — with human approval gates on anything that ships. Under the hood: an OpenAI-compatible proxy, multi-provider model routing with automatic failover, a three-role plan → execute → verify agent loop, and full observability. MIT licensed.

Start with the audit — no signup, no repo access, no trust required
The entry point is deliberately the lowest-risk thing an agency can do: read-only analysis.
- 102 deterministic checks across six pillars: Technical SEO, Content, Security headers, Social, GEO (generative-engine optimization: llms.txt, AI-crawler access, citable anchors) and AIO (answer-engine optimization: JSON-LD structured data, E-E-A-T markup)
- 0–100 health score, overall and per pillar
- Revenue-at-risk quantification — pass your monthly organic revenue and every finding is priced (a clearly-labeled model estimate, never a fabricated loss)
- Screaming Frog-compatible CSV exports — drops into existing SEO workflows
- Repo-aware auto-fix — connect a repo later and the agent proposes dry-run diffs for fixable findings (
apply=truewrites them) - An agent-ready delegation plan — every finding comes back as a WSJF-prioritized work package assigned to a specialist. That's the handoff from "audit" to "agency."

Then the agency takes over — at your pace
Trust is granted in steps, never all at once:
- Read-only — audits, uptime/TLS monitoring, stack-drift detection, CVE scans. Zero write access.
- Dry-run — agents propose diffs, draft PRs, draft replies. You read everything before it exists anywhere real.
- Gated writes — agents open PRs, update docs, triage tickets. Nothing merges, deploys, or messages externally without your explicit approval. High-stakes actions always pause; you choose which low-risk classes of work to auto-approve.
After onboarding, the standing schedules run themselves: website health every 30 minutes, security audit daily, stack-change detection daily, code-quality scan daily, trend watch every 6 hours, docs sync on every push. You talk to a CEO agent in plain English ("fix the memory leak in issue #142"); it decomposes the job, delegates to the right specialist, and returns results with evidence — PR link, test output, reasoning trace.

Honest model economics
- The free 24h sandbox runs on free-tier models (Cerebras, Groq, NVIDIA NIM) with automatic failover. It demonstrates the orchestration loop end to end; it is not the output quality you'd run a company on.
- Production runs on your infrastructure with your keys. Anthropic Claude, OpenAI-compatible endpoints, AWS Bedrock, NVIDIA NIM, Groq, Cerebras, DeepSeek, and local Ollama are all supported by the same router — point the brain at a top-tier model from the Providers screen and every specialist upgrades instantly, no redeploy.
- No data leaves your server. No cloud relay, no usage telemetry, no shared inference endpoint, no per-seat pricing.

Setup (self-hosted)
Python 3.13+, Node 20+, and either Ollama or a free NVIDIA NIM API key. No Kubernetes, no cloud account — SQLite mode needs no database server at all.
git clone https://github.com/strikersam/autonomous-ai-agency.git && cd autonomous-ai-agency
python -m venv .venv && source .venv/bin/activate
pip install -r backend/requirements.txt
cp .env.example .env # minimum: STORAGE_BACKEND=sqlite, SECRET_KEY, ADMIN_EMAIL/PASSWORD, NVIDIA_API_KEY
uvicorn backend.server:app --host 0.0.0.0 --port 8001
cd frontend && npm install && REACT_APP_BACKEND_URL=http://localhost:8001 npm start
Then open http://localhost:3000, paste your company URL, and onboard. Full setup, cloud deployment (Render + Cloudflare + GitHub Pages), and every configuration variable: docs/platform-guide.md · docs/configuration-reference.md

Architecture, security, license
The stack is a React SPA (Cloudflare Worker / GitHub Pages) over a FastAPI backend (Render / Docker) with swappable MongoDB/SQLite storage, a ModelRouter for task-aware model selection, and a persisted workflow state machine with HITL gates — the full diagram and the honest feature-maturity matrix are in docs/platform-guide.md.
Security posture: no secrets in source (env-only, validated at startup) · JWT Bearer auth on every endpoint · three-role RBAC · per-task git worktree isolation · Bandit SAST + CodeQL + secret scanning on every push · dependency CVE audit on every PR · audit log for all admin actions.
